Pharmacy Manager / Director jobs in Walton, Georgia involve overseeing pharmacy operations, managing staff, and ensuring compliance with regulations. Responsibilities include developing policies, monitoring budget, and optimizing patient care. Required qualifications typically include a PharmD degree, state licensure, and several years of experience in a managerial role. Pharmacy Manager / Director in Walton, Georgia oversees the operations of a pharmacy, ensuring the highest quality of patient care and adherence to regulations. - Entry-level Pharmacy Technician salaries range from $25,000 to $35,000 per year - Mid-career Pharmacy Manager salaries range from $85,000 to $100,000 per year - Senior-level Director of Pharmacy salaries range from $120,000 to $150,000 per year The role of Pharmacy Manager / Director in Walton, Georgia has a rich history dating back to the early days of pharmaceutical practice. Pharmacists have played a crucial role in dispensing medications and providing healthcare advice to the community. Over the years, the position of Pharmacy Manager / Director has evolved to encompass a wider range of responsibilities, including inventory management, staff supervision, and ensuring compliance with state and federal regulations. The focus has shifted towards a more patient-centered approach, with an emphasis on medication therapy management and preventive care. Current trends in the field of pharmacy management in Walton, Georgia include the integration of technology to streamline processes, the expansion of clinical services offered by pharmacies, and a growing emphasis on collaboration with other healthcare providers to optimize patient outcomes. The role of Pharmacy Manager / Director continues to be vital in ensuring the safe and effective delivery of pharmaceutical care to patients in the community.
